Bitcoin Stalls at $80K Amid Nvidia Surge
The price of Bitcoin has stalled at around $80,000 after reaching a high of $81,280 overnight. The eight consecutive days of inflows into US spot Bitcoin ETFs totaling $2.8 billion have been a significant factor in the recent price movement.
Solana was the standout performer among major cryptocurrencies, rising more than 4% on the day and 20% over the past week.
Nvidia's quarterly revenue of $96.2 billion and forecast for over $105 billion next quarter sent its stock surging 9%, driving a boost in the tech sector as a whole.
The Nasdaq rose 1.6%, the S&P 500 gained 0.7%, and the Dow added 0.2% on the back of Nvidia's results, but markets are now focused on Fed Chair Kevin Warsh's first Jackson Hole keynote for signals ahead of the September FOMC meeting.
